Anca Benera und Arnold Estefán, Alumni of the Solitude Exchange Network, will represent Romania at the Venice Biennale 2026

Anca Benera und Arnold Estefán (Alumni of the 2021 Solitude Exchange Network) will represent Romania at the Venice Biennale 2026 with Black Seas – Scores for the sonic Eye a video and sculptural–sound installation.
The work, curated by Corina Oprea and Diana Marincu, listens to the Black Sea as a living, shifting archive.
Plural by nature, the Black Sea is a dynamic field of forces – ecological, political, and historical – where past and present, human and more-than-human, biology and technology, ecology and militarization continuously shape one another. Traces of these crossings persist beneath the surface, layered in sediments, data, and the quiet debris of conflict. Benara und Estefán pose the question of whether sound can reveal what history leaves submerged.
Venue: Giardini della Biennale, Venice; Romanian Institute of Culture and Humanistic Research – Venice, Palazzo Correr, Cannaregio 2214, Venice
Exhibition dates: June 9 –November 22, 2026
